Website offering information for teens with epilepsy to get information about managing their seizures and preparing for adulthood. Teens have a chance to get to know other teens living with epilepsy and learn ways to navigate life with epilepsy. Parents will have the opportunity to get tools and advice on parenting their teen who is living with epilepsy as they transition into adulthood.
Resources include information about Epilepsy, seizures various treatments, getting ready to see a doctor when transitioning to adulthood, career planning and post high school.
